Ms. Liberi - Librarian at Shroder High School Shroder Students Focus on ReadingThe objective at Shroder, as a member of the High Schools that Work consortium, is to have students read up to 25 books per year. The Shroder LMC has added some incentives such as a reading contest by grade level and a book club that meets twice a month open to all grade levels. In addition, middle school students at Shroder will participate in the Scholastic Reading Inventory and Reading Counts programs. With these programs in place students are encouraged to read above their currently identified reading levels.
